I was having trouble getting a good ground for my amp, where is the best place to hook up the ground wire on an 1985 firebird, a really need to know.

Gee.., be nice OntoGenesis. Its easy but some concern should be taken when grounding. I'm going to assume that your amp is in the trunk, so what ever you do, don't drill into the gas tank!! Thats one big no-no. The best place I found is the metal divider between the back storage compartment and the spare tire bay. Theres a short metal wall that works perfectly fine and is usally in range of the 3 ft. cable they give you with most amps. Hope this helps out.
